### Queue-depth autoscaler (Pridwell ingest)

Autoscaler watches the `ingest-main` queue on Pridwell. Scale-out triggers at sustained depth over threshold for 3 minutes; scale-in waits 15. Last week's flapping was caused by the warmup window being shorter than consumer boot time — fixed Tuesday. Do not override replica caps manually; the reconciler reverts within one cycle. If paging fires, check consumer lag first, then depth. Current production settings are as follows.

service settings:
[zorath]
host = zorath.qirvanlabs.internal
user = zorath_svc
database = zorath_prod

Team,

Quick note for the new contractor: the Heatherfield timetable solver now handles split-shift teachers correctly. Staging is refreshed; rerun your conflict checks against the Milldown sample term before signing off. No schema changes this round, so no migration needed. Report anything odd in the release channel. The candidate is pinned to the build listed below.

pipeline stamp: htk9_6ce9d33c5

## Retrying Failed Exports

Hey, welcome aboard! When reviewing PRs touching the export retry path in Cartwheel, keep an eye on the backoff logic — we've been bitten twice by retries hammering the Pondside warehouse. Exports that fail three times land in the dead-letter queue, and the replay tool re-signs each payload before resubmitting. Reviewers should verify the replay tool is invoked with the right environment, since staging and prod use different signers. The replay job authenticates with the deploy key shown below.

deploy key for kahof-tadup: bky4_rRMZ

## Runbook: Flightpath Gateway WebSocket Reconnect Loop

Since the 4.2 rollout, Flightpath clients occasionally enter a tight reconnect loop when the gateway drops idle sockets. The bug stems from the client treating a 1006 close as an auth failure and re-handshaking without backoff, which amplifies load on the token service. Mitigation: enable the jittered-backoff flag and verify the session resume endpoint accepts stale nonces within the grace window. To query the token service audit log during review, authenticate with the key below.

gateway credential: kto23_LX9A4ys6i4nzHtpOLNLodKK